Important Notice

2010/04/15

     From 3 May 2010, the Embassy of the People's Republic of China will not accept cash payment for visa/ passport/ notarization/ authentification fees.

Applicants are kindly required to:

1)Do deposit or bank transfer into our account in FNB;

2)Pay through a speed point machine in our office at collection window;

3)Pay by cheque in our office at collection window(cheque payment are not recommended because the process of cashing may take long). Payment should be made before the date of collection so that we can verify with the transaction history of our account issued by FNB. Please note that payment on the date of collection may result in passport/visa releasing declined. 

For collection, applicants are required to present the Pick-up Form and proof of payment.
